Compartilhar via


COleServerItem::OnDoVerb

Chamado pela estrutura para executar o verbo especificado.

virtual void OnDoVerb(
   LONG iVerb 
);

Parâmetros

  • iVerb
    Especifica o verbo a ser executado.Pode ser qualquer um dos seguintes procedimentos:

    Valor

    Significado

    Símbolo

    0

    Verbo primário

    OLEIVERB_PRIMARY

    1

    Verbo secundário

    (Nenhum)

    – 1

    exibição de itens para edição

    OLEIVERB_SHOW

    – 2

    edição item na janela separada

    OLEIVERB_OPEN

    – 3

    Ocultar item

    OLEIVERB_HIDE

    O valor – 1 geralmente é um alias para outro verbo.Se não houver suporte para edição aberta, – 2 tem o mesmo efeito que – 1.Para obter valores adicionais, consulte IOleObject::DoVerb in the Windows SDK.

Comentários

Se o aplicativo contêiner foi gravado com o Microsoft Foundation classe biblioteca, essa função é chamada quando o COleClientItem::ativar função de membro do correspondenteCOleClientItem objeto é chamado. A implementação padrão chama o OnShow membro funcionar se o verbo primário ou OLEIVERB_SHOW for especificado, AoAbrir se o verbo secundário ou OLEIVERB_OPEN for especificado, e OnHide if OLEIVERB_HIDE foi especificado. A implementação padrão chama OnShow Se iVerb não é um dos verbos listados acima.

Substitua essa função se o verbo primário não mostrar o item.Por exemplo, se o item é uma gravação de som e o verbo primário for Play, não seria necessário exibir o aplicativo do servidor para executar o item.

Para obter mais informações, consulte IOleObject::DoVerb in the Windows SDK.

Requisitos

Cabeçalho: afxole.h

Consulte também

Referência

Classe COleServerItem

Gráfico de hierarquia

COleClientItem::ativar

COleServerItem::OnShow

COleServerItem::OnOpen

COleServerItem::OnHide

Outros recursos

COleServerItem membros